What Specifically Is actually a French Drain?
A French drain is actually a form of drain system developed to reroute surface area water and groundwater out of particular locations, especially cellars and groundworks. It contains a trench full of crushed rock or rock that contains a perforated pipeline at its base. The key feature? To stop flooding and water accumulation that can bring about significant structural damage.
How Performs a French Drain Work?
French drains job by collecting water as it circulates into the trench, infiltrating the rocks or stone just before entering the perforated water pipes. Once inside this water pipes, the water is guided off of your property-- normally in to an assigned drain location or even storm sewage system-- consequently decreasing hydrostatic stress on basement walls and stopping moisture intrusion.

The Refine of Putting up French Drains
Step-by-Step Installation Guide
Assessment: Assess your residential or commercial property for locations prone to flooding. Design Strategy: Partner with your contractor to produce a helpful format adapted to your landscape. Excavation: Take trenches where needed, usually extending at the very least 6 inches wide. Gravel Level Positioning: Add rocks or even smashed stone at the bottom of each trough for optimal drainage. Installation of Perforated Water pipes: Set perforated water pipes on top of the rocks layer. Backfilling Trench: Cover pipes along with more rocks prior to backfilling with soil.Maintenance Considerations

FAQs Regarding Installing French Drains
1. The amount of does it cost to put in a French drain?
The expense varies based upon aspects such as size and depth yet normally varies coming from $1,000 to $5,000 relying on complexity.
2. Can easily I put up a French drain myself?
While DIY installations are actually feasible for proficient property owners, choosing specialists makes sure compliance along with regional codes and optimum functionality.
3. For how long carries out installation take?
Commonly between someday to many times relying on dimension; much larger ventures may demand additional time.
4. Perform I need authorizations for setting up a French drain?
Yes! Lots of communities demand authorizations; inspection nearby guidelines prior to starting any project.
5. Will putting up a French drain do away with all moisture problems?
While helpful at reducing extreme wetness concerns, combining this solution with additional waterproofing steps may be important for comprehensive protection.
6. How frequently must I cleanse my French drains?
It is actually suggested to assess them yearly and clean out any type of debris accumulation every handful of years.
